Last weekend Vail hosted the first Vail Gay Ski Week which turned out to be a huge success. People attending had a blast.  Many people from all over the country, especially the East Coast, California and the Denver area traveled to Vail and enjoyed awesome snow, parties and events the Vail Gay Ski Week team came up with. Most people showed up Thursday for the first event- the Women Wrestling in Samanas. Nobody ever imagined that women wrestling could be such fun. The 10 woman wrestler gave their best and even more… People watching were pushing each other to get the best spot in order to see the girls rolling on the floor.  Then Friday morning most went out skiing and then getting ready for the Beer Bust. The Beer Bust Friday night was the first big party. Hosted in the Donovan Pavillion in Vail, the cowboy themed party was a great party. People enjoyed drinks and dancing to DJ Sammy Jo till midnight. Saturday morning seemed kind of slow. Registration was open at 8am but most people showed up later which was related to the Beer Bust and dancing the night before ….But once up, groups of skiers and boarders went out together and enjoyed the amazing Colorado weather and snow on the slopes. After skiing most went back to the Vail Plaza to relax in the Plaza Hot Tub and enjoy some drinks to prepare for the final party Saturday night – the POPular Party.  During the Popular Party with dj guillaume the silent auction was taking place approaching final bits for its closing at midnight. The Vail Gay Ski Week team managed to get amazing prices from resorts, art galleries, sport shops, hotels…on which participants were biting on. Most people at the party took advantage of the fact that they were staying right at the party place, the Vail Plaza, so that they could party really hard and then just roll in their room once the party was done at 2am. Sunday morning was even slower than Saturday…most participants decided to relax and then simply check out and travel home with amazing memories and looking forward to Vail Gay Summer and the next Vail Gay Ski Week.

The 37th annual Vail Lacrosse Shootout is already underway and will continue to thrill Vail Valley residents through the 5th of July.  The weather is perfect, the competition is fierce and the stakes are high as America’s top lacrosse players show off their talent in the Vail Shootout. Touted as one of the premier lacrosse tournaments nationwide, the Vail Shootout hosts nearly 100 men’s and women’s team from all over the United States. The Four Seasons will open its first resort in Colorado in late 2009, just in time for next season’s ski year! The Vail location will be called “The Four Seasons Residence Club Vail”, and will offer both fractional and whole ownership residences along with 121 hotel rooms.

The Four Seasons at the base of Vail Mountain will be an intimate ambiance and size, with just 16 properties available for full-ownership, and 19 properties available for fractional-ownership, only 10 of which are still available for sale.

April real estate numbers indicate a good sign and a gradual boost in Vail’s market economy. Land Title Guarantee Company has published April’s numbers, which show that April is the second best month thus far both in dollar volume, $57,567,700, and in transactions, 54, since January 01, 2009. These numbers are down in comparison to April 2008 sales by about 58%.

Fractional ownership is different from timeshares in many ways. Firstly, the value of your property can appreciate. Secondly, the property is a deeded interest, so you can will it down to family members, versus only being able to have it for 30 years (with no included property restoration). The hotel, condo association, or property management company that rents out the fraction of your ownership keep up with the property in the most prestigious fashion so down the road, those fractional properties will continue to sell and resell.

What you will typically find in timeshares is that property management companies don’t put any money into the restoration of the property so at the end of a long period the timeshare property essentially depreciates in value, thus losing its market of renters.

Vail is becoming an increasingly popular summer destination for outdoor adventure gurus from around the world. The small town of about 4,500 people is surrounded by White River National Forest and divided by the Colorado River, where you will often find people relaxing on tubes, fishing, kayaking, and more! Vail is also a great place for camping trips and hiking, with popular wilderness area, Mount of the Holy Cross (at 14,005 feet!), just 14 miles away from Vail Mountain. The town’s population drops dramatically in the summer, so you don’t get the sensation that we’re a “tourist trap” destination when you stay here. Bars and nightclubs are filled with regulars. The Teva Mountain Games, held annually in Vail, starts in just 7 days! Come out and enjoy the world’s largest celebration of outdoor adventure athletics, from traditional outdoor sports such as running, cycling, climbing and kayaking to less-conventional competitions like the “Speed Retrieve” and “Extreme Vertical” Dog Events! The Teva Mountain Games is kicking off summer nightlife activities with free concerts in Vail Village starting at 6 pm all three nights of the Games! Not only can you watch professional adventure athletes from around the world compete in seven sports and 21 disciplines, you, yourself, can get involved and compete against professional and amateurs, alike, in certain sections of the running, hiking, mountain-biking, road-biking, and kayaking competitions! If you’re interested in getting involved in the Teva games but aren’t much of an athlete, show off your skills in the Photo competition, enjoy the collection of films by the Telluride Mountainfilm: Zero Emission Tour, or help volunteer with a trail clean-up sponsored by Bear Naked and the U.S. Forest Service.

The Teva Mountain Games is a project by the Vail Valley Foundation, a nonprofit organization since 1981 that has been commited to servicing the Vail Valley community by providing leadership in enterprises centered around our local neighborhood.
